-%% @doc Static resource handler.
-%%
-%% This built in HTTP handler provides a simple file serving capability for
-%% cowboy applications. It is provided as a convenience for small or temporary
-%% environments where it is not preferrable to set up a second server just
-%% to serve files. It is recommended to use a CDN instead for efficiently
-%% handling static files, preferrably on a cookie-less domain name.
-%%
-%% If this handler is used the Erlang node running the cowboy application must
-%% be configured to use an async thread pool. This is configured by adding the
-%% `+A $POOL_SIZE' argument to the `erl' command used to start the node. See
-%% <a href="http://erlang.org/pipermail/erlang-bugs/2012-January/002720.html">
-%% this reply</a> from the OTP team to erlang-bugs
-%%
-%% == Base configuration ==
-%%
-%% The handler must be configured with a request path prefix to serve files
-%% under and the path to a directory to read files from. The request path prefix
-%% is defined in the path pattern of the cowboy dispatch rule for the handler.
-%% The request path pattern must end with a `...' token.
-%%
-%% The directory path can be set to either an absolute or relative path in the
-%% form of a list or binary string representation of a file system path. A list
-%% of binary path segments is also a valid directory path.
-%%
-%% The directory path can also be set to a relative path within the `priv/'
-%% directory of an application. This is configured by setting the value of the
-%% directory option to a tuple of the form `{priv_dir, Application, Relpath}'.
-%%

-%% == ETag Header Function ==
-%%
-%% The default behaviour of the static file handler is to not generate ETag
-%% headers. This is because generating ETag headers based on file metadata
-%% causes different servers in a cluster to generate different ETag values for
-%% the same file unless the metadata is also synced. Generating strong ETags
-%% based on the contents of a file is currently out of scope for this module.
-%%
-%% The default behaviour can be overridden to generate an ETag header based on
-%% a combination of the file path, file size, inode and mtime values. If the
-%% option value is a non-empty list of attribute names tagged with `attributes'
-%% a hex encoded checksum of each attribute specified is included in the value
-%% of the the ETag header. If the list of attribute names is empty no ETag
-%% header is generated.
-%%
-%% If a strong ETag is required a user defined function for generating the
-%% header value can be supplied. The function must accept a list of key/values
-%% of the file attributes as the first argument and a second argument
-%% containing any additional data that the function requires. The function
-%% must return a term of the type `{weak | strong, binary()}' or `undefined'.
-%%
